LOS ANGELES - Actor Uma Thurman has accused movie producer Harvey Weinstein of sexually assaulting her at a London hotel after they worked together on the 1994 hit film “Pulp Fiction.” In a New York Times article on Saturday by columnist Maureen Dowd, Thurman broke her silence after saying in October that she would wait to speak out about inappropriate behavior in the workplace because she did not want to say anything in anger. Thurman became the latest of more than 70 women who have accused 65-year-old Weinstein of sexual misconduct, including rape. Weinstein’s lawyer said on Saturday that the producer had immediately apologized to Thurman for making an “awkward pass” at her 25 years ago, but that her claims about being physically assaulted were untrue. In the Times article, Thurman, 47, said Weinstein pushed her down when she met him in his suite at London’s Savoy Hotel. “He tried to shove himself on me. He tried to expose himself. He did all kinds of unpleasant things. But he didn’t actually put his back into it and force me,” she told the newspaper. Asked for further comment by Reuters, a representative for Thurman said the Times article spoke for itself. Weinstein’s lawyer, Ben Brafman, said the producer was stunned and saddened by what he considered false allegations from someone he worked closely with for more than two decades. “Mr Weinstein acknowledges making an awkward pass at Ms Thurman 25 years ago which he regrets and immediately apologized for,” Brafman said in a statement. “Why Ms Thurman would wait 25 years to publicly discuss this incident and why according to Weinstein, she would embellish what really happened to include false accusations of attempted physical assault is a mystery to Weinstein and his attorneys.” Brafman said Thurman’s statements to the Times were being carefully examined and investigated “before deciding whether any legal action against her would be appropriate.” (rtr)
MINNEAPOLIS - Justin Timberlake caused a national controversy when he performed the Super Bowl halftime show with Janet Jackson in 2004, and the pop singer said on Thursday not to expect his partner in crime to appear this time around. Timberlake on Sunday will return to America’s biggest stage 14 years after a “wardrobe malfunction” overshadowed his last gig at the National Football League’s championship game. “To be honest I had a ton of grand ideas about special guests. There’s a whole list. I think Vegas has a lot of odds on it. From NSYNC to (Jay-Z) to Chris Stapleton to Janet,” Timberlake told a news conference in Minneapolis. “But this year... my band, the Tennessee Kids, I feel like they are my special guests and I am excited this year to rock the stage and it’s going to be a lot of fun.” Timberlake infamously ripped off part of Jackson’s garment during their halftime show performance in Houston and briefly bared her breast. The incident coined the phrase “wardrobe malfunction.” The Parents Television Council published an open letter to Timberlake on Thursday asking the 10-times Grammy winner to keep his performance, which is estimated to draw more than 100 million viewers, friendly and safe for children. “The fallout of your performance during Super Bowl XXXVIII has left an indelible mark. You really threw us – and millions of parents who were watching with their kids,” the group wrote. “The now-infamous wardrobe malfunction was the biggest news story for weeks, even at a time when the nation had launched into war in Iraq.” The letter continued, “We ask you to keep the halftime show friendly and safe for the children watching, and who may be hoping to emulate you one day.” (rtr)

Four workers killed in railway project crane collapse in Matraram Here are ten workplace accidents occurred in the public and private construction projects:
1. On August 4, 2017, two workers of Light Rail Transit (LRT) construction project in Palembang fell to deaths from an LRT pole. 2. On September 22, 2017, the bridge at the Bocimi (Bogor-Ciawi-Sukabumi) toll road construction in Bogor District collapsed and killed one worker and injured two others. 3. On October 26, 2017, a crane at the Bogor Outer Ringroad (BORR) toll road construction fell on a public highway. 4. On October 29, 2017, a girder at the Pasuruan-Probolinggo (Paspro) toll road construction collapsed and killed one of the workers. 5. On November 15, 2017, a concrete of the LRT construction project fell on a car at Jalan MT Haryono in East Jakarta.
6. On November 16, 2017, a crane that carried a variable message sign was involved in an accident at the Jakarta-Cikampek Toll road near the Elevate Jakarta-Cikampek Toll road project. 7. On December 9, 2017, two girder rods of the Ciputrapinggan Bridge construction collapsed. 8. On December 26, 2017, a ceiling at the Pakubuwono Spring Apartment collapsed. 9. On December 30, 2017, a girder rod collapsed at the Pemalang-Batang toll road construction site. 10. On January 4, 2018, six massive girder rods collapsed at the Depok - Antasari toll road project after the rods were accidentally knocked over by an excavator.
JAKARTA - A crane collapse early on Sunday at the construction site of a railway track in Matraman, East Jakarta, has killed four workers and injured five others. The crane, which was used to lift rail pads for a four-track railway project that will link Jakarta to Cikarang, collapsed at 5 a.m. near Jl. Matraman Raya. The deceased were taken to Cipto Mangunkusumo Hospital in Central Jakarta, while the injured were taken to Premier Hospital in East Jakarta. The East Jakarta Police reported that five workers were operating the crane. The police seized the helmets, vests, shoes and ID cards of the victims as evidence. Yadi, a resident, said the crane had fallen at the site several times, but it was only this morning that it had taken lives. “The crane has collapsed several times, once it fell on a house,” he said, as quoted by
wartakotalive.com. Last month, a box girder at the construction site of the light rapid transit (LRT) project in Utan Kayu, East Jakarta, fell in the early hours of the morning, injuring five workers.
